I say add a set of heads and a cam.. Since your on a tight budget, I have a buddy that has a set of cast iron GT-40's (reg GT-40's not GT-40P's) off of a 96 Explorer, complete 80,000miles he is only asking $350, and a machine shop could freshen them up for less then $300 (valve job, springs etc) and you'd be ready to go! [email protected]

A good cam would also help maximize the combo with the heads, you can use all your supporting hardware, but I'd get a 70mm TB....
 
I dont think you are making 300 fwhp quite yet...but i bet you are up around 275-280. You still have a real good start an seeing as u already have the cobra upper and lower...i would get a real good set of heads and a cam....and then port match the lower to the new heads. I think with that combo you will see close to 350 hp...good luck man

You guessed it. The fuel pump would be the first to go (300hp max), then the injectors (320hp max), the thottle body wouldn't be a bad choice ( I would go to a 70MM) and the RR's are nice but you need to figure out what lift your going to run. I would run a different cam and the 1.6RR's. Sounds like a pretty quick ride if it only tips the scale at 2900lbs.
